Brake pads Textar or Duralast
I recently got the dynamic friction rotors and pad kit to replace the oem rears and I like them so far. It’s only been about 500 miles, but in my opinion are a little better at stopping compared to the oem. Plus the price was really good.
Duralast stuff is fine. Their pads are fine. Their pads also have a lifetime warranty through AutoZone.
I did change my F30 with Textar and it was plug n play. No need to go big if you don’t go on track days often imo.
I went with Dynamic Friction instead after hearing lots of negative feedback, so far very happy 6 mo later. I drive fast and they stop very well. Does produce quite a bit of brake dust though.
I beat the hell out of some OE Textars in 110+ heat at Buttonwillow and they held up admirably. You don’t need anything more for the street.
I have Dynamic friction 5000 low metallic pads on my 21 3.3 G70 RWD and love them, better bite but dust a bit more than OEM but no brake judder for the 5k miles I've had them on so far.
I always had good results with textar and Zimmerman.
I use all Textar disks and pads and they are excellent.
I haven't done VW brakes in a while, but I usually use Textar pads on my BMW and Mini. They are OE supplier for most of the BMW brakes, but they do make a lot of dust.
I replaced my brake pads with Textar pads and they are squealing so bad that it is embarrassing to drive it around town. If you are standing outside the car it hurts your ears. I had Porsche sand down the edges of the discs and this has helped a little but not to the point I am satisfied. Although the pads are only a month old I have decided to replace them with another brand.
